Qwinton Origin and Meaning
The name Qwinton is a boy's name.
Qwinton is a distinctive masculine name that represents a creative spelling variation of Quinton or Quentin. The original name Quentin derives from Latin roots meaning "fifth," historically given to a fifth-born child. The modern spelling with "Qw" emerged as part of the trend toward unique name spellings, particularly in the late 20th and early 21st centuries. While maintaining the same pronunciation as Quinton, this spelling offers a more distinctive visual identity. The name has a contemporary feel while still connecting to a name with historical roots. Though not among the most common names in popularity rankings, Qwinton appeals to parents seeking something familiar in sound but unique in presentation.
